CVE-2020-0504

21
FAUCET Score

CVE-2020-0504 describes a buffer overflow vulnerability in Intel Graphics Drivers, affecting versions prior to 15.40.44.5107, 15.45.30.5103, and 26.20.100.7158. This flaw carries a high CVSS score of 7.8, indicating that an authenticated local user could potentially achieve escalation of privilege and denial of service. While there is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code, or Metasploit/Nuclei modules, the vulnerability has garnered some community discussion and media coverage. Its EPSS score is very low, suggesting a low likelihood of future exploitation.
